It is all the talk around town - Waubonsie Valley and Neuqua Valley going head-to-head tonight in the heart of downtown Naperville at North Central College to compete for bragging rights.
As always the football rivalry between the two schools remains heated with trash talking coming from both sides. The taunting for this highly anticipated match up started as early as last February, when the Neuqua men's basketball team devastatingly defeated the Warriors in the semi-sectionals to end the Waubonsie's great season. Characteristically, Waubonsie's fans just wouldn't stand for it and immediately chanted,"Wait until football! Wait until football!" Ever since then Facebook groups have started and are full of school pride and trash talk against the opposing school.
Being a part of the student body at Waubonsie, I'm very involved and full of Warrior pride. I know the importance of this game and what it means to bring home a victory. Especially considering how Waubonsie beat Neuqua last year in stylish fashion and that never in the history of this rivalry have the Warriors pulled off consecutive victories.
Although Waubonsie's 0-3 record nor Neuqua's 1-2 record are very pleasing to fans on either side, both teams know that they can lose every game, but if they win this game then all the other losses mean nothing. This is the game all the students, players and fans talk about. In the end, this game determines who gets to control bragging rights for the rest of the year and for Waubonsie, a second victory is school history.
